Kentucky Climate Summary
For the Period 10-09-2025 to 11-07-2025

Temperatures for the period averaged 55 degrees across the state which was 0 degrees from normal and 16 degrees cooler than the previous period. High temperatures averaged from 68 in the West to 65 in the East. Departure from normal high temperatures ranged from 0 degrees from normal in the West to 2 degrees cooler than normal in the East. Low temperatures averaged from 45 degrees in the West to 42 degrees in the East. Departure from normal low temperature ranged from 0 degrees from normal in the West to 0 degrees from normal in the East. The extreme high temperature for the period was 88 degrees at FORT CAMPBELL and the extreme low was 0 degrees at CARBONDALE ASOS.

Precipitation (liq. equ.) for the period totaled 3.57 inches statewide which was 0.15 inches above normal and 104% of normal. Precipitation totals by climate division, West 3.70 inches, Central 4.18 inches, Bluegrass 3.12 inches and East 3.29 inches, which was -0.03, 0.64, -0.21 and 0.20 inches respectively from normal. By station, precipitation totals ranged from a low of 0.00 inches at MONTICELLO AWOS to a high of 5.95 inches at Greensburg.
